Counter-Strike 2 is the free-to-play successor to CS:GO, a tactical 5v5 shooter defined by precise gunplay, economy management, and deep competitive play built on the new Source 2 engine.

Ehrgeiz blends classic arcade beat‑'em‑up action with role‑playing elements, letting players choose from a roster of fantasy characters and customize their moves. The game supports both solo campaigns and competitive multiplayer, including split‑screen battles. Originally released in 1998, the title features a variety of arenas, weapon pickups, and a combo system that rewards timing and strategy. Its blend of fighting mechanics and RPG progression makes it a unique entry in the action‑fantasy genre.
